Ara Güler Müzesi, a photography museum dedicated to the life and work of the renowned photojournalist Ara Güler, opened on 16 August 2018—the 90th birthday of its founder. The building sits at Bomontiada, in the Şişli district, and presents Güler’s photographs that illuminate life in Istanbul and Turkey in the latter half of the 20th century. The museum not only exhibits images but also houses an extensive archive and research center, the Ara Güler Arşiv ve Araştırma Merkezi (AGAVAM), created to classify, preserve, digitize, and index hundreds of thousands of works. An archive team led by an art consultant from the Doğuş Group contributed to a two-year project to make the collection accessible to researchers and photography enthusiasts via an online portal. …
